stringtranslate.com

PowerQUICC

PowerQUICC es el nombre de varios microcontroladores basados ​​en PowerPC y Power ISA de Freescale Semiconductor . Están construidos alrededor de uno o más núcleos PowerPC y el módulo de procesador de comunicaciones ( motor QUICC ), que es un núcleo RISC independiente especializado en tareas como E/S , comunicaciones, ATM , aceleración de seguridad, redes y USB . Muchos componentes son diseños de sistema en un chip hechos a medida para aplicaciones integradas .

Los procesadores PowerQUICC se utilizan en aplicaciones de redes, automotrices, industriales, de almacenamiento, de impresión y de consumo. Freescale utiliza procesadores PowerQUICC como parte de su plataforma mobileGT .

Freescale también fabrica microcontroladores QUICC basados ​​en la antigua tecnología 68k .

Hay cuatro líneas distintas de procesadores, basadas principalmente en la potencia de procesamiento.

PowerQUICC I

El procesador de servicios Freescale XPC855T de un Sun Fire V20z

La familia MPC8xx fue el primer procesador integrado basado en PowerPC de Motorola, adecuado para procesadores de red y dispositivos de sistema en un chip . El núcleo es una implementación original de la especificación PowerPC. Es un núcleo de cuatro etapas con una sola emisión, con MMU y unidad de predicción de ramificación con velocidades de hasta 133 MHz. El MPC821 se introdujo en 1995 junto con el MPC860 con un motor QUICC completo. Una versión reducida, el MPC850 con cachés reducidos y puertos IO llegó en 1997. El módulo de procesador de comunicación QUICC (CPM) descarga las tareas de red de la CPU, por lo que esta familia se denomina PowerQUICC . Todos los procesadores de la familia difieren en las características en chip como controladores USB, seriales, PCMCIA, ATM y Ethernet y diferentes cantidades de cachés L1 que van desde 1 KiB hasta 16 KiB.

MPC8xx : todos los procesadores PowerQUICC comparten este esquema de nombres común.

PowerQUICC II

MPC8245 en un conmutador de canal de fibra Qlogic SANbox 5200

PowerQUICC II se introdujo en 1998 y es el descendiente directo de PowerPC 603e y el núcleo también se conoce con el nombre de 603e o G2 . Los procesadores aún tienen cachés L1 de instrucciones/datos de 16/16 KiB y alcanzan frecuencias de hasta 450 MHz. Estos procesadores de comunicaciones se utilizan en aplicaciones como sistemas VoIP , conmutadores de telecomunicaciones , estaciones base celulares y DSLAM . La familia de procesadores PowerQUICC II se eliminó gradualmente en favor de la línea más potente PowerQUICC II Pro. No hay planes para un mayor desarrollo de este núcleo.

MPC82xx – Todos los procesadores PowerQUICC II comparten este esquema de nombres común.

PowerQUICC II Pro

Introducido en 2004, basado en el núcleo e300 , un núcleo PowerPC 603e mejorado , con cachés L1 de instrucciones/datos de 32/32 KiB. PowerQUICC II Pro se utiliza como procesadores de red para enrutadores , conmutadores , impresoras , almacenamiento conectado a red , puntos de acceso inalámbricos y DSLAM . Los procesadores PowerQUICC II Pro alcanzan los 677 MHz y pueden incluir una multitud de tecnologías integradas como USB , PCI , Ethernet y dispositivos de seguridad. También utilizan un motor de descarga de red QUICC Engine más nuevo en lugar del CPM utilizado en las series PowerQUICC I y PowerQUICC II originales. El controlador de memoria proporciona soporte para SDRAM DDR y DDR2.

MPC83xx : todos los procesadores PowerQUICC II Pro comparten este esquema de nombres común. Una "E" al final significa que los procesadores tienen un módulo de cifrado integrado. Todos los dispositivos con un nombre 834x carecen del motor quicc, mientras que los dispositivos con un número como 836x lo tienen.

PowerQUICC III

Los procesadores PowerQUICC III se basan en un núcleo Power ISA v.2.03 de 32 bits llamado e500 , introducido en 2003. Tiene una doble emisión, un pipeline de siete etapas con FPU de doble precisión, cachés L1 de datos e instrucciones de 32/32 KiB, múltiples Gigabit Ethernet, PCI y PCIe, RapidIO , controladores de memoria DDR/DDR2 y aceleradores de seguridad. Las velocidades varían de 533 MHz a 1,5 GHz. Estos procesadores están destinados a aplicaciones de telecomunicaciones y redes de nivel empresarial, almacenamiento de alta gama, impresión y procesamiento de imágenes. Algunos de los procesadores utilizan el módulo CPM más antiguo para gestionar la descarga de procesamiento de red, algunos utilizan el motor QUICC más nuevo (igual que en PowerQUICC II Pro) y algunos no tienen un motor CPM o QUICC en absoluto. No obstante, el departamento de marketing de Freescale marca todos los dispositivos de la serie 85xx como "PowerQUICC III".

MPC85xx : todos los procesadores PowerQUICC III comparten este esquema de nombres común. La "E" final significa que los procesadores tienen un módulo de cifrado integrado.

Futuro

PowerQUICC dejará de desarrollarse [ ¿ cuándo ? ] en favor de la plataforma QorIQ compatible con software que incluye todos los procesadores basados ​​en PowerPC e500 , desde los de un solo núcleo hasta los de múltiples núcleos y hasta los de 32 núcleos. Freescale seguirá fabricando procesadores PowerQUICC en el futuro cercano para los clientes existentes, pero ayudará a facilitar la transición a QorIQ.

Véase también

Referencias

Enlaces externos